SUMMARY:finance seminar - Rongrong Sun
DTSTART:20241210T093000Z
DTEND:20241210T110000Z
DESCRIPTION:This paper builds a three-stage sequential logit model to exami
 ne bank credit demand and constraints faced by non-agricultural self-employ
 ed households in China. Our analysis reveals a stark reality: In 2013 and 2
 015\, over half of self-employed households seeking bank loans faced credit
  constraints\, either discouraged from applying or rejected by banks. While
  we found no evidence of gender or age discrimination in loan approvals\, f
 actors like wealth\, saving status\, education and financial literacy signi
 ficantly impact the likelihood of credit demand\, application\, and grantin
 g. Notably\, less wealthy and less-educated households are significantly mo
 re likely to be credit constrained\, highlighting the need for targeted pol
 icy interventions to promote self-employment. Furthermore\, our findings su
 ggest that informal loans often supplement bank loans in financing self-emp
 loyment businesses\, implying a potential underestimate of credit constrain
 ts in the bank credit market. \\n\\nContact: Eric Girardin: eric.girardin[
